Rock & Roll Saxophone (Book/CD Pack)
A study of the basic techniques and sound effects used in rock & roll performance,
including photos and biographies of players from 1955 to the 1990s. CD features
guest performances by Myanna, Jenny Hill, and The Burning Grass. Techniques covered
include the growl, flutter tone, altissimo register, reed squeal, double tone, slap
tongue, note bending and sliding, trill, special effect, and more.

Contemporary Saxophone (Book/CD Pack)
This book contains info on: creating solos; selecting a sax, mouthpiece, reed and
ligature; mics and sound systems; choreography; and more. Includes an artists' equipment
list, discography, and CD performances by Jay Davidson and Don Wise.
